Madison County, ID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Madison County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Madison County Studio Apartments | $865 | $865 | $865 |
| Madison County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,070 | $750 | $1,299 |
| Madison County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,207 | $850 | $1,595 |
| Madison County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,500 | $1,500 | $1,500 |
| Madison County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,800 | $1,800 | $1,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Madison County
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in Madison County, ID?
As of today, September 14, 2026, there are currently 120 available Madison County apartments priced from $750 to $1,800, with an average monthly rent of $1,184.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Madison County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Madison County ranges from $750 to $1,299 with an average monthly rent of $1,070.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Madison County c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Madison County range from $850 to $1,595.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,207.
